Do I Really Need a Bio? And What Should It Say Any Way?/b]
Presenter: Sylvie Sadarnac-Studney, Principal, Kedrika Communications
A professional biography is your signature, your calling card; it is your permanent imprint on a world saturated with thousands of messages a day. But how do you write a good, solid bio that both encapsulates what you are about and makes the reader want to know more?
In this session, you will receive specific, concrete tips on how to write a good bio. You will take part in interactive exercises to find the words that most fittingly describe who you are and what you do.
You also will learn about how online social networking is changing the rules of making connections, and how to fine-tune your bio into a virtual marketing tool.
Please bring your current bio if available.
